What are concho bail bonds and how do they work?
Concho bail bonds are a type of surety bond provided by licensed bail agents in Concho County to help individuals secure their release from jail by paying a percentage of the total bail amount. By using concho bail bonds, a defendant can get out of jail while awaiting trial, ensuring they can maintain their job, family, and responsibilities. It's important to understand the terms of the bond and what is required for successful completion.
-
How much do concho bail bonds typically cost?
The cost of concho bail bonds varies based on the total bail amount set by the court and typically ranges from 10% to 15% of that amount. For example, if the bail is set at $10,000, you might expect to pay between $1,000 and $1,500 for the concho bail bond. Additional fees may apply, depending on the bail bond company's policies and requirements.

Are there any eligibility requirements for concho bail bonds?
Eligibility for concho bail bonds typically requires that the defendant has a valid form of identification and is facing charges that are bailable. Some bail bond agencies may also check the individual's criminal history, employment status, and potential flight risk. It's best to consult with the bail bond agent to understand specific requirements unique to your situation.
-
Can I use collateral for concho bail bonds?
Yes, collateral can be used for concho bail bonds to secure the bond, especially if the bail amount is high or if the individual has a signNow criminal history. Acceptable forms of collateral may include property, vehicles, or other valuable assets. Discussing collateral options with your bail agent can help you make the best decision for your financial situation.
